Jesse settled into our new 'home' in Duluth |
Awakened to heavy rains – what ND and MN farmers are calling
a “million dollar rain” after a dry spring with sparse precipitation – and
winds gusting to 35 mph that made driving a large sided vehicle against side
winds interesting. We rolled into Duluth
and found our way to the Lakehead Boat Basin to a nice RV site within the boat
yard/marina. Forecast is to near
freezing again tonight with some sun coming our way in the next day or two. We’ll be in Duluth for a few days before
heading east once again. Our view is out
the front windshield to the EPA’s “Lake Explorer II” that monitors water
conditions on the Great Lakes and a marina full of boats including a sail boat
from Seattle on the hard for repairs.
Odometer at 2000miles since we left home a week ago.
